‘Vesuvius’

This is probably the worlds best known volcano. As well as visiting Pompeii and seeing the damage a volcano can do to a city, Vesuvius is an impressive backdrop for any trip. It’s also relatively easy to get to, you can drive up to within 200 metres of the summit. You then have to climb almost vertically on a spiralling walkway to get to the rim, but it’s worth it.

‘Vesuvius’

Vesuvius used to erupt regularly but has been quiet since its last eruption in 1944. This is the famous volcano that destroyed Pompeii and Herculaneum in 79 A.D. and thus is a must-see for volcanophiles as well as anyone interested in history. The ruins of Pompeii and Herculaneum, and the many paintings and artifacts from there on display in the nearby Naples Archaeological Museum, are endlessly fascinating. In addition to the fantastic wall paintings (such as those in the Villa dei Misteri near Pompeii) one can

contemplate shops, bars, bath-houses, and palatial estates, all of which were buried by blisteringly hot pyroclastic flows from Vesuvius. Even the death throes of its victims can be seen: at Pompeii, plaster casts of human and animal victims were made by pouring plaster into holes in the ash where bodies had fallen, showing details of clothing and even facial expression. In Herculaneum, humans and animals alike sought shelter in boathouses and were incinerated there; their skeletons can now be seen in the positions in which they died. In both places the tableau of bodies huddled together in positions reflecting agony and terror are poignant testimonials to this horrific natural disaster of ancient times. Vesuvius is easily climbed, as a road goes most of the way up; at the top, there are great vistas of the Bay of Naples, and one can gaze down into Vesuvio’s precipitous, simmering crater to contemplate when it will go off again.
